What dress style is most flattering?

Belted styles, drop-waist dresses, swing dresses, dresses with an embellished top or an empire waist all fit this criterion. A-line dresses, wrap dresses, and dresses with full skirts are also great options, as they help conceal the midsection.

What type of dress makes you look slimmer?

Any dress that does not have a belt a shift, fit and flare, empire, raised waist, trapeze is going to be more body-friendly to you now than separate tops and bottoms since there’s no break at the waist. One-piece dresses glide over curves and balance body proportions, so you look more even, too.

How can I hide my belly fat in a tight dress?

Wrap a belt or a sash high on the thinnest part of your waist. While you do not want to draw attention to your belly, most women carry that extra belly fat low. If you wear a complementary belt or sash up at the narrowest part of your waistline, it will highlight your slimmest area.

What kind of dresses hide belly fat?

Empire line: When it comes to dresses to hide a tummy, empire line styles come up on top. They draw attention to the smallest part of your torso by nipping in directly beneath your bust. The rest of the dress should have a flared, A-line fit which floats over the stomach.

What should you not wear if you have big breasts?

Don’ts: High-necked tops or turtlenecks make the upper body seem shorter. Tops and dresses with flounces and ruffles can make the bust look bulkier. … Tops and dresses with spaghetti or neck holder straps offer little support.

What is a FUPA?

Excess fat over the area right between your hips and above your pubic bone is sometimes known by the slang term FUPA (fat upper pubic area). It’s also called a panniculus. Childbirth, aging, rapid weight loss, and genetics can all contribute to fat in this area.

What jeans to wear if you have a big stomach?

Choose mid-rise or high-rise jeans for the most flattering cut. Mid-rise and high-rise jeans help to support and cover your belly. These jeans are the most flattering shape if you have concerns about your tummy. Avoid wearing low-rise jeans.

How can I make my stomach look flat in a dress?

Go Vertical: If you’re trying to make your stomach look flat, or any other body part for that matter, go vertical with the pattern! Horizontal patterns make you look broader than you are, which is why vertical ones are a perfect option since they add length to your body, and make you look slimmer than you are.

What body type can wear a fit and flare dress?

A fit & flare is best for these body types: Athletic shapes will love it for the extra curve. And since the fit-and-flare resembles an hourglass on the hanger, it’s an obvious fit for hourglass shapes.

Do bigger clothes make you look bigger?

Oversized statements When you wear bigger clothes, you look bigger no matter your size. Plus, oversized looks can often seem sloppy. Instead, work your outfits to your advantage with well-fitting (not tight!) garments that glide over your shape.

Why do I look fatter in shapewear?

Women sometimes try to size down to add extra firmness, Joy says. But that makes you look bigger because it can cause bulges, and it can be uncomfortable. Too-tight shapewear may lead to health problems, says neurologist Orly Avitzur, MD, medical advisor for Consumer Reports.

Do Tight clothes make you look bigger?

In short, wearing anything too tight will make you appear heavier than you really are. The answer to looking thinner is not about packing yourself into ill-fitting clothing, it’s about wearing clothing that flatters your figure and accentuates the positive, while detracting from the negative.
